Cruising destinations Conveniently situated in Southern Italy, Cala Ponte Marina provides unrivalled access to a yachting Paradise, bordering the Adriatic Sea to the East, the Ionian Sea to
the South-East and the Strait of Otranto and the Gulf of Taranto to the South. Its most Southerly portion, known as the Salento peninsula, forms the high heel of the ‘boot’ of Italy. Destinations in nautical miles are: Bari 18; Trani 30; Brindisi 40; Vieste 71; Otranto 80; Santa Maria di Leuca 103; Tremiti Islands 105; Porto Montenegro, Tivat, Montenegro 108; Gallipoli 130; and Corfu 146.
